SEBI has revised the Social Stock Exchange framework to ease fundraising by not for profit organizations. A not for profit organization may now remain registered on the SSE without raising funds for an extended period, subject to Social Stock Exchange approval. The minimum subscription threshold for issuance of Zero Coupon Zero Principal Instruments has also been relaxed where the funds can still be deployed in a viable and meaningful manner aligned with the disclosed object of the issue, and the Social Stock Exchange must conduct due diligence before in-principle approval. The circular also requires disclosure of how balance capital will be raised and the impact of under-subscription, with refund mandatory if the minimum subscription is not achieved.
